Tiny Titans: Discover the Particles That Make Up the Universe – A Science Adventure for Curious Kids
Get ready to shrink down to the tiniest levels of existence—where particles dance, atoms build everything you see, and mysteries of the universe unfold like magic.
Tiny Titans is the ultimate kid-friendly guide to the invisible world inside us all. Aimed at curious minds ages 8 to 12, this science adventure blends fascinating facts with imaginative storytelling to introduce readers to the real stars of the universe: electrons, quarks, photons, neutrinos, and more.
Follow the journey of discovery as scientists unravel one mind-blowing mystery after another—from the first glimpse of an electron to the search for dark matter. With vibrant explanations, real scientist spotlights, and a sense of cosmic wonder, this book makes subatomic science feel like an epic adventure.
Perfect for classrooms, home learning, STEM-loving kids, or any reader who’s ever looked up at the stars and wondered what makes everything tick.
Inside You’ll Explore:
The particles that make up all matter—and how they fit together
Famous scientists and the discoveries that changed everything
Antimatter, cosmic rays, and particles from exploding stars
The tools scientists use to uncover the invisible
What we still don’t know—and why it matters
Whether you're a future physicist or just full of questions, Tiny Titans will show you a universe you’ve never seen before.
